Documents to Request

Compliance Documents to Request & Organize

Where supplier documentation is available and subject to supplier cooperation. Plutonia does not issue certifications.

Europe Humanitarian & Tender Procurement — document set

Plus shipment documentation: commercial invoice, packing list, certificate of origin where applicable, and bill of lading or airway bill.

Frequently Asked Questions

Can Plutonia support European tenders?
Yes. Plutonia supports tender and donor-funded procurement with supplier verification, integrity and responsible-sourcing documentation, quality control, and audit-ready project compliance packs.
Does Plutonia guarantee tender approval?
No. The compliance pack supports review; it does not guarantee outcomes or constitute legal attestation.
Can you provide anti-corruption declarations?
Yes. Plutonia provides reusable supplier integrity and anti-corruption declaration support.
Can you deliver to project destinations?
Plutonia coordinates freight and documentation to nominated points; final in-country legs are typically handled with the buyer's logistics partner.
